Web4 okt. 2024 · Why does iodine turn starch blue when added to water? Iodine Test Using iodine to test for the presence of starch is a common experiment. A solution of iodine …
WebThe change in colour is due to the formation of polyiodide chains from the reaction of starch and iodine.
